A collection of instrumental gems by the most beloved composers of the late baroque. Antonio Vivaldi’s charming flute concerto “Il Gardellino” (the Goldfinch) with
its trills and little scales inspired by the beautiful voice of a little bird. Georg Frideric Handel’s organ concerto conceived and written in a most light and playful style in order to entertain a large audience in between performances of other large works such as Oratorios.
Johann Sebastian Bach’s double concerto for oboe and violin, and especially the fantastic Brandeburg Concerto n. 2 where all instruments are challenged with a
virtuoso writing. An evening of pure music at its best.

PROGRAM
Johann Sebastian Bach: Brandenburg Concerto n. 2 for flute, oboe, violin and trumpet
Johann Sebastian Bach: Double Concerto in D minor for Oboe, Violin, Strings and Harpsichord
Antonio Vivaldi: Concert in D major "Il Gardellino" for flute and strings
Georg Friedrich Handel: Concerto for organ and orchestra in B flat
